Money Saving Tips

Use coupons with sale items:

Obviously using grocery coupons will save you some money but if you plan ahead you'll save a lot more money. Look at the weekly circulars the come out and find coupons for items that will be on sale. Or, save the coupons for the items you want to buy and wait for that item to go on sale.

Double or Triple Coupons:

Many stores will double or even triple coupons on certain days. If you can get an item that is on sale with a double (or a triple) coupon, you'll save big. You could even get some items for FREE.

Combine Coupons:

You may think that combining coupons is not allowed but many stores will allow you to use a store coupon and a manufacturers coupon on the same item. This allows you to get a much bigger discount and you can even get some items free.

Be on the Lookout for Rebates:

Some items have rebates. If you get a double coupon when you buy the item, the rebate could make it free or you might even come out ahead. :-)

Stick to Your List:

With careful planning you can get some items for free and save a whole bunch of money on many others. Stick to your list and don't buy any impulse items unless you stuble upon a deal that is simply too good to pass up.

The stores know that people will buy impulse items so many items are sold very inexpensively to get you in the store where they are counting on you to also buy the more expensive items. Well, I think you should disappoint them and just go for the bargains.
